Location: Buttevant, Co. Cork 

About Viska Systems: 

At Viska Systems, we’re not just transforming industries, we’re shaping the future of AI and automation. As a company recognised for excellence and innovation and named Best AI-Powered Machine Vision & Robotics Company 2025 by the Irish Enterprise Awards, we specialise in seamlessly integrating Machine Vision, Robotics, and Software Development to deliver innovative automated inspection systems that enhance product quality and improve operational efficiency.  

We’re looking for a Systems Engineer to join our team in Cork. This is your opportunity to play a key role in shaping the future of AI and machine vision and drive efficiency across industries. 

 

Technical Responsibilities:

  • Embedded Software Development: Build robust applications across front-end and back-end platforms, with emphasis on scalability and maintainability. Work with Gstreamer pipelines, open-source vision models, Git, and Docker. Optimise hardware use for machine vision workloads, and support the full development cycle, bringing code from prototype through testing into production. 
  • Code Quality, Version Control, & Deployment: Write efficient, testable code and manage repositories using Git, and deploy using tools like Docker. 
  • Production Control: Identify and resolve critical bugs and production issues quickly and independently. 
  • System Assembly 
    Lead the build of machine systems, guiding technicians through both mechanical assembly and electrical wiring. 
  • Project Documentation 
    Accurately complete ISO9001 documentation, including requirement specs, bills of materials, and testing and reporting records. 
  • Team Leadership 
    Provide technical leadership by onboarding and mentoring new team members, including acting as a lead for junior engineers. 

 

What We’re Looking For:

  • Software Development Expertise: 5+ years in a hands-on systems engineering role using Python, ideally in a startup or small-team environment. Proven experience owning production-grade systems from design through deployment and support.  
  • Educational Background: Master’s Degree in Computer Engineering, or Mechatronics / Electronics or a related technical field. 
  • Specialised Knowledge: AI technologies, machine learning frameworks, open-source vision tools such as OpenCV and YOLO. 
  • Software Development Methodologies: Experience with Agile or Scrum processes. 
  • Software Tools: Experience with GIT and Docker. 
  • Initiative: Proven ability to work independently and show initiative in a fast-paced environment. 
  • Mentorship: Experience supporting or mentoring junior engineers. 
  • DevOps: Familiarity with DevOps practices and tools (e.g., Git, CI/CD, Docker) is an advantage. 

 

Why Work for Us? 

At Viska Systems, we offer a dynamic environment where your contributions directly impact our success: 

  • Competitive Compensation: A strong starting salary with a comprehensive benefits package. 
  • Career Advancement: Structured mentorship and clear pathways for career development in software engineering. 
  • Cutting-Edge Technology: Work on innovative, award-nominated AI solutions that are shaping the future of manufacturing and automation. 
  • Training & Development: Access to ongoing training to deepen your technical expertise in AI, machine vision, and software development. 
  • Collaborative Team Culture: Join a dynamic and supportive team that values your ideas and contributions. 

 

Ready to Join Us? 

Take the next step in your career with Viska Systems and become part of a company at the forefront of AI-driven innovation.  

Please note, you must be eligible to work in Ireland.  

You can send your CV to: careers@viska.ie  with “Systems Engineer” in the subject line.